Exporters must comply with Malaysian customs regulations, including accurate tariff classification and proper export declarations.
All imports are subject to Brazilian customs clearance through Siscomex and can require import licenses (LI) for controlled items.

When shipping from Tanjung Pelepas, Malaysia to Salvador, Brazil, prepare for significant delays due to the Southeast Asia Monsoon Season (May-November) and Brazil's Wet Season (October-March). Add extra buffer days to schedules and be cautious of tight transshipment connections during peak rainfall (November-February). Maintain communication with carriers for real-time updates, as localized flooding can disrupt inland transport (July-October). Additionally, secure vessel space and equipment well in advance during harvest peaks (February-September) to mitigate congestion risks.

For humidity-sensitive games, select a two-stage approach: inner sealed plastic bag around the product or retail box, then a double-wall box with cushioning. Add Desiccant packs for long-distance or ocean shipments of toys and games.
For most sports equipment and leisure products, a general-purpose container normally works, but exporters should check door seals and use drying agents. For High-value board games with sensitive cardboard or printed materials, Consider additional interior lining on routes with tropical climates.
To reduce stacking damage for moderately heavy sports equipment and leisure products, select higher burst-strength cartons, control pallet height, and use edge protectors. Mark pallets of Toys with “No Top Load” where appropriate, and make sure heavier Sporting goods are not loaded on top of lighter leisure products.
Yes, many countries have product safety and labeling rules for certain leisure products. Exporters should check that all Toys meet destination standards (such as ASTM/EN standards) and that Documentation is available if customs requests it. Some Sporting goods, such as items with aerosols, may also fall under hazardous materials rules and require declared classification.
Because toys and leisure products often have strong resale value and are vulnerable to humidity issues, arranging shipment insurance is advisable. Cover your games at Full replacement value and Confirm that the policy includes water damage, especially for ocean or long-term storage moves.
Shipping Toys & Sporting Goods from Malaysia to Brazil requires compliance with Brazilian customs regulations, including proper classification under the Harmonized System (HS) codes, and adherence to safety standards set by the Brazilian National Institute of Metrology, Quality and Technology (INMETRO). Importers must also provide necessary documentation such as commercial invoices, packing lists, and certificates of origin.
